Good things do come in threes.

April Smith’s luxurious Las Vegas wedding crashed and burned when her wealthy fiancé cheated on her and left her with a hotel bill that costs more than she makes in a year. Even more humiliating, her college ex-boyfriend Quinn Taylor has come to her rescue and bailed her out. They didn’t part on the best of terms and never expected to see one another again.

For Quinn, April was the one who got away and despite the heartache she caused him, he’s never gotten over her. Not wanting to be in his debt, April makes Quinn a tempting offer: she’ll spend the next month with him during his Vegas vacation, fulfilling his fantasies. Being with April has always been Quinn’s number one fantasy, and next on the list is sharing a woman with his best friend and business partner, Austin Wright. Since he can see an undeniable attraction between April and Austin, he makes that a condition of their deal, too.

Enjoying the attention and affection from two hot and handsome men, April gives in to her desires to be with both of them. But with those desires comes a growing love that she fears may force her to choose between Quinn and Austin—or lose them both.

Ruthie☆☆☆☆
This is a really hot read – be warned! It starts out rather hard and I was ready to give Quinn a bit of a slap, even if he was coming to April’s rescue. He may have known her long ago and feel that she left him for another guy with more money, but he is still pretty unkind. Luckily, as the story progresses, his feelings are at least explained, and as his agreement with her plays out, the tables are somewhat turned and this second chance may just be everything he ever wanted.

April is a curious character, as she is seemingly under the thumb of her fiancé, yet she gives it all up due to having a backbone and morals. That he would then dump everything onto her and behave so despicably undoubtedly shows she made the right decision, but not an easy one. So we find her downtrodden, yet she shows great fire when faced with Quinn and Austin. It is an engaging mix, and can possibly be explained by her difficult childhood, and need for security. As the men understand this better, they finally deal with it better too.

Sexy, fun, and the damsel in distress definitely gets her knights in shining armour coming to provide her with security and love twice over – lucky April!


Mary☆☆☆☆
April is in Vegas to get married but she catches her fiancé cheating. Now the wedding is off, and she is stuck with a huge hotel bill. While the hotel staff is searching for things her fiancé bought at the hotel gift shop, a man happens to walk into the room. Turns out the man is her old college boyfriend. Can this day get any worse for April?

Quinn hadn't seen April since college and thought he never would see her again, not since she left him for another man. One who had more money, at least that is what he thought. After Quinn hears about April's troubles, he makes her an offer and it is one she cannot refuse because she has nowhere else to go.

Spending the month with Quinn and Austin might be fun but not falling in love with them will be hard. She tells Austin about her troubles with her ex-fiancé, what all he took from her. Why she can go home, and he feels that they can work something out.

This story was good and has the potential to be better, it seemed to be wishy-washy at times. I liked the idea of April with Quinn and Austin and the way they were with her. The threesome was great together. Although Quinn had to learn the real reason why she ditched him in college and that helped him towards her, but he seemed to want to be hateful almost. Anyway, I liked it and will be looking for the next story from this author.


Avid Reader☆☆☆
M/F/M Romance
Triggers: Cheating

April is left with a huge hotel bill by Maurice when she catches him cheating. She is also further humiliated by him when she happens to run in to her ex-love, Quinn, and he agrees to help her. April doesn't like to feel that she is taking handouts. But when Maurice takes it a step further and demands, literally, the clothes off her back, Quinn has had enough.

Quinn doesn't really know what happened all those years ago. He thought he was over it. Turns out, he was just burying the pain. Seeing April again, he can't help but feel like the lost guy he was when she first left.

Austin is attracted to her in a way he didn't know he was capable of. He sees that Quinn is struggling with his own attraction, along with the desire to make April feel as much pain as he did. Austin knows that he wants April forever, but can he convince Quinn of that fact too?

The chemistry between these three is off the charts. My main issues with the story are Quinn taking things too far with April. He wants so badly to punish her and in the beginning I very much felt that he used her and abused her, and he was not my favorite character. He knew her feelings and simply disregarded them and I didn't like that at all. It took a while for me to forgive him. Also, Maurice's role, despite not being a big one, was disruptive and the resolution with him was less than satisfying. I had to go back and find what it was. Overall, it was entertaining though.

 

 

Author Bio

OPAL CAREW is the author of over twenty erotic romances for St. Martin’s Press, including Blush, Secret Weapon, Forbidden Heat, Six, and the Ready to Ride series. She lives in Canada and makes regular trips to the U.S. to speak at conferences and industry events.
